When are the battery issues going to be addressed for my Droid razrmaxx hd since the kitkat updat??
FLwaterman
Newbie

The reason I purchased a droid razr maxx hd was for the excellent battery usage.  I was very happy with it till the kitkat update.  Now I have virtually no battery life, when before I could go at least 3 days.  I took it in to the local Verizon store and they were very nice, and tried the factory reset - spent a couple of hours -  no help.  I have tried to remain patient, assuming with so many documented problems that a fix would be in the works -   I'm running out of patience.  I would be happy if you could just come up with some way to go back to jellybean.   I am unable to use the phone for more than emergency contact, and have to keep it on airplane mode for the battery to last at all.  Please help!!!

Re: When are the battery issues going to be addressed for my Droid razrmaxx hd since the kitkat updat??
Jakeman1
Master - Level 1

Have you disabled any of the bloatware on the phone such as Backup Assistant, Smart Action etc....? and which version of Google Play and Google Play Services are you running?  The versions of Google Play Services that were released with KitKat had some issues with excessive Battery Usage. Of you click on menu>Battery and see ANDROID OS as being the top usage of battery it is this issue and you should change the services version.
